Amarok/Manual/Organization/CollectionScanning/pt-br: Difference between revisions

From KDE Wiki Sandbox
(Created page with "* Você pode acionar a reanálise de uma pasta se modificar a sua hora de modificação (por exemplo, se usar o <code>touch</code> na linha de comando).")
No edit summary
 
(48 intermediate revisions by 2 users not shown)
Line 5: Line 5:
Sempre que o '''Amarok''' está mostrando uma coleção, as informações sobre as faixas e álbuns precisam ser obtidas a partir de uma origem.
Sempre que o '''Amarok''' está mostrando uma coleção, as informações sobre as faixas e álbuns precisam ser obtidas a partir de uma origem.
A origem pode ser um dispositivo portátil, um serviço na Internet ou um banco de dados.
A origem pode ser um dispositivo portátil, um serviço na Internet ou um banco de dados.
Para as faixas que estão armazenadas no sistema de arquivos, o '''Amarok''' está usando um banco de dados para ter um acesso rápido aos metadados necessários.
Para as faixas existentes nas pastas da '''Coleção local''', o '''Amarok''' está usando um banco de dados para ter um acesso rápido aos metadados necessários.
Na primeira vez é necessário importar esta informação para o banco de dados, o que é feito normalmente com a análise das pastas da coleção a procura de arquivos de áudio.
Na primeira execução é necessário carregar estas informações para o banco de dados, o que é feito normalmente com a análise das pastas da '''Coleção local''' em busca de arquivos de áudio.
Este processo é chamado de análise da coleção.
Este processo é chamado de análise da coleção.


Line 13: Line 13:
===== Análise incremental / Atualizar coleção =====
===== Análise incremental / Atualizar coleção =====


A análise incremental irá procurar nas pastas da coleção por atualizações.
A análise incremental irá procurar por atualizações nas pastas da coleção.
Isto normalmente é feito a cada minuto, mas também poderá ser acionado manualmente se escolher a opção <menuchoice>Atualizar coleção</menuchoice> no menu.
Isto é feito a cada minuto se a opção <menuchoice>Monitorar as alterações nas faixas</menuchoice> estiver ativada, mas também poderá ser acionada manualmente ao escolher a opção <menuchoice>Atualizar coleção</menuchoice> no menu.


A análise incremental irá verificar apenas a data de modificação de cada pasta da coleção, em comparação com a última data de modificação conhecida.
A análise incremental irá verificar apenas a data de modificação de cada pasta da coleção, em comparação com a última data de modificação conhecida.
Isto tem algumas implicações:
Isto tem algumas implicações:


* Você pode acionar a reanálise de uma pasta se modificar a sua hora de modificação (por exemplo, se usar o <code>touch</code> na linha de comando).
* Você pode acionar a reanálise de uma pasta se modificar a sua hora de modificação (por exemplo, se usar o <code>touch /caminho/pasta</code> na linha de comando).


* If files inside a directory are changed the scanner will not notice, because changing a file updates its modification time but not the time of the parent folder.
* Se os arquivos dentro de uma pasta forem alterados, o analisador não irá perceber a alteração, pois a alteração de um arquivo atualiza a sua hora de modificação, mas não a hora de modificação da pasta-mãe. Por outro lado, a maioria dos programas que modificam arquivos, fazem-no de forma atômica, usando um arquivo temporário que depois é renomeado. Esse procedimento atualiza a hora de modificação da pasta e, assim, aciona uma nova análise da pasta.


* If the collection folders are on a very slow partition the process of checking all the modification times can take some time. Usually this information is cached by the operating system but with large collections that might not be possible. In such a case the scanner might appear to scan continuously. With collections above 5000 tracks or when collections are stored on a network drive or an NTFS partition it is recommended to switch off the <menuchoice>Watch folders for change</menuchoice> option.
* Se as pastas da coleção estiverem em uma partição muito lenta, o processo de verificação de todas as horas de modificação poderá levar algum tempo. Normalmente, esta informação fica em cache no sistema operacional, mas com grandes coleções isso pode não ser possível. Nesse caso, o analisador pode parecer que continua indefinidamente. Em coleções com milhares de pastas ou quando as coleções são armazenadas em uma unidade de rede ou partição NTFS, recomenda-se desativar a opção <menuchoice>Monitorar pastas por alterações</menuchoice>.


If you have problems with deleted tracks still appearing in the collection, or you want to update album covers (which are not updated by a mere "update collection") then you can use the <menuchoice>Full rescan</menuchoice> option in the settings dialog.
Se tiver problemas com as faixas excluídas que continuam a aparecer na coleção, ou caso queira atualizar as capas do álbum (que não são atualizadas ao executar a opção <menuchoice>Atualizar coleção</menuchoice>), então você poderá usar a <menuchoice>Análise completa</menuchoice> na janela de configurações. A <menuchoice>Análise completa</menuchoice> não se preocupa com datas de modificação e não excluirá as estatísticas dos arquivos existentes. No entanto, excluirá as estatísticas das faixas que desapareceram das pastas da coleção que estiverem montadas. Por este motivo, é aconselhável efetuar a <menuchoice>Análise completa</menuchoice> apenas com todas as pastas da '''Coleção local''' montadas, se mover as faixas entre montagens. A <menuchoice>Análise completa</menuchoice> também atualiza o número de reproduções se o que estiver armazenado nas etiquetas dos arquivos for maior, a classificação se a música ainda não estiver classificada e as etiquetas dos arquivos que tiverem informações sobre as classificações e pontuações (nas mesmas circunstâncias).
<menuchoice>Full rescan</menuchoice> will not care about modification dates. It will not delete your statistics; it will, however, restore ''rating'' and ''playcount'' if stored inside the file.


===== Progress bar / scanning time =====
===== Barra de progresso / tempo de análise =====


The progress bar will show the progress of the scanning.
A barra de progresso irá mostrar a evolução da análise.
Up to 50% the scanner will scan the file system and just buffer the result.
Até os 50%, o analisador irá verificar o sistema de arquivos e registrar temporariamente o resultado. O período acima dos 50% indica que o analisador está armazenando os resultados no banco de dados. Normalmente, o segundo passo é muito mais rápido que o primeiro, por isso não se surpreenda caso a barra de progresso avançar rapidamente.
Times above 50% indicate that the scanner is committing the results to the database.
Até os 50% é possível interromper a análise. Após os 50%, a gravação dos dados não pode ser interrompida.
Usually the second step is much faster than the first so don't be surprised if the progress bar seems to jump.
Up to 50% aborting the scan is possible. After 50%, the committing of the files can not be stopped.


The scanning time depends on your disk speed and other factors.
O tempo de análise depende da velocidade do seu disco e de outros fatores.
Usually the first scan is a lot slower than subsequent scans where the files are cached by the operating system.
Normalmente, a primeira análise é bem mais lenta que as seguintes, pelo fato de que os arquivos se encontram na cache do sistema operacional.
A scan of 10000 files should take around three minutes on a modern computer. 50000 files should be around 13 minutes.
Uma análise de 10.000 arquivos deve levar cerca de três minutos em um computador moderno. 50.000 arquivos deve demorar cerca de 13 minutos. Obviamente, com uma unidade SSD isto será muito mais rápido.


===== Backup of collection =====
===== Cópia de segurança da coleção =====


With the default settings '''Amarok''' is storing all the collection information in a directory called <tt>~.kde/share/apps/amarok/mysqle/</tt> . It can be a good idea to make a backup of this directory from time to time, especially when you didn't enable the writing back of statistics information.
Com a configuração padrão, o '''Amarok''' armazena todas as informações da coleção em uma pasta chamada <tt>~.kde/share/apps/amarok/mysqle/</tt>. Pode ser uma boa ideia fazer uma cópia de segurança desta pasta de tempos em tempos, principalmente quando não tiver ativado a reposição da informação das estatísticas.


===== About unique ids =====
===== Sobre os IDs únicos =====


'''Amarok''' is tracking files by an id that is either stored in the audio track or computed by the artist, album title and track title meta information.
O '''Amarok''' registra os arquivos com base em um ID que é armazenado na faixa de áudio ou calculado com base nos metadados do arquivo, nos metadados das etiquetas e nos primeiros kilobytes do arquivo.
This id helps '''Amarok''' to identify tracks that are moved to other locations so that statistics informations (rating, score, playcount) are not lost.
Este ID ajuda o '''Amarok''' a identificar as faixas que foram movidas para outros locais, para que as informações estatísticas (classificação, pontuação, número de reproduções, primeira e última reproduções) não sejam perdidas.
Currently '''Amarok''' will not import tracks with duplicate unique ids.
Atualmente, o '''Amarok''' não irá importar as faixas com IDs duplicados.
This leads to the surprising behavior that copied tracks still appear only once in '''Amarok'''.
Isto leva a um comportamento estranho, onde as faixas copiadas aparecem apenas uma vez no '''Amarok'''.


In some circumstances even different tracks can end up with the same unique id. That is very uncommon and usually the result of running years of unstable '''Amarok''' releases.
Em algumas circunstâncias, até mesmo faixas diferentes poderão ficar com o mesmo ID único. Estes problemas podem ser vistos no resultado de depuração (inicie o '''Amarok''' com a opção --debug em um terminal) durante a análise.
Such a problem can be seen by the debug output (start '''Amarok''' with the --debug option) while scanning.


If you are using 2.4 beta you might run into a case where most of the collection is not imported. This can be easily seen by the failing sql commands in the debug output. In such a case just use 2.4 final.
===== Sobre os álbuns =====


===== About Albums =====
O analisador só pode ler faixas individuais, mas o '''Amarok''' irá mostrá-las ordenadas pelo álbum e compilação (um álbum sem artista específico). O '''Amarok''' não consegue se basear na pasta onde os arquivos estão localizados, uma vez que os esquemas de organização das pastas variam bastante.


The scanner can only read single tracks but '''Amarok''' will display those sorted by album and compilation (an album without one specific artist). '''Amarok''' can't rely on the directory in which the files are located, since directory organizational schemes vary so widely.
O analisador está fazendo o seguinte:


The scanner is therefore doing the following:
* As faixas sem um artista ou álbum  (ou um compositor, no caso de uma faixa de música clássica) são colocadas em uma compilação.


* Tracks without an album artist or an artist (or a composer in case of a classical track) are placed in a compilation.
* As faixas que estejam marcadas como compilações ou com um artista do álbum que não seja ''vários artistas'' serão colocadas em um álbum.


* Tracks that have the compilation flag set or an album artist other than "various artists" will be placed in an album.
* As faixas que tenham a marca de compilação como 0 são colocadas em uma compilação.


* Tracks that have the compilation flag set to 0 are placed in a compilation.
* Os álbuns chamados "Best of", "Anthology", "Hit collection", "Greatest Hits",  "All Time Greatest Hits" e "Live" são sempre tratados como um álbum.


* Albums called "Live", "Greatest Hits" and a couple of other names are always regarded as an album.
* Se tiver concluído com várias faixas de diferentes artistas serão colocadas dentro de uma compilação; por outro lado poderá criar um álbum com base nelas.


* If we end up having tracks with several different artists left over they are placed inside a compilation, or else we make one album out of them.
Este processo é bastante complicado. Entretanto, normalmente os resultados das análises podem ajudar a descobrir o motivo pelo qual as faixas são ordenadas desta forma.
Nesse caso, tente executar (na linha de comando) {{Input|amarokcollectionscanner -r '''''~/sua/pasta/músicas'''''}}
Procure pelas etiquetas "compilation" e pelas faixas com diferentes etiquetas de "artista" e "artista do álbum".


This process is quite complicated. However usually the outputs of the scanner can help in figuring out why the tracks are sorted as they are.
Você pode remover a etiqueta de ''compilação'' dos arquivos MP3 com o seguinte comando: {{Input|id3v2 -r TCMP '''''seu nome de arquivo aqui'''''}}
In such a case try executing (on a command line) {{Input|amarokcollectionscanner -r '''''~/Music/directory'''''}}
Look for "compilation" tags and tracks with different "artist" and "albumartist" tags.
 
You can remove the tag from mp3 files with the following command: {{Input|id3v2 -r TCMP '''''your fileename here'''''}}




{{Prevnext2
{{Prevnext2
| prevpage=Special:myLanguage/Amarok/Manual/Organization/Collection | nextpage=Special:myLanguage/Amarok/Manual/Organization/Collection/SearchInCollection
| prevpage=Special:myLanguage/Amarok/Manual/Organization/Collection | nextpage=Special:myLanguage/Amarok/Manual/Organization/Collection/SearchInCollection
| prevtext=Collection | nexttext=Search in Collection
| prevtext=Coleção | nexttext=Pesquisar na coleção
| index=Special:myLanguage/Amarok/Manual | indextext=Back to Menu
| index=Special:myLanguage/Amarok/Manual | indextext=Retornar ao Menu
}}
}}


[[Category:Amarok]]
[[Category:Amarok2.8/pt-br]]
[[Category:Multimedia]]
[[Category:Multimídia/pt-br]]
[[Category:Tutorials]]
[[Category:Tutoriais/pt-br]]

Latest revision as of 17:12, 4 July 2013

Other languages:

Analisando coleção

Sempre que o Amarok está mostrando uma coleção, as informações sobre as faixas e álbuns precisam ser obtidas a partir de uma origem. A origem pode ser um dispositivo portátil, um serviço na Internet ou um banco de dados. Para as faixas existentes nas pastas da Coleção local, o Amarok está usando um banco de dados para ter um acesso rápido aos metadados necessários. Na primeira execução é necessário carregar estas informações para o banco de dados, o que é feito normalmente com a análise das pastas da Coleção local em busca de arquivos de áudio. Este processo é chamado de análise da coleção.

É útil compreender o processo de análise para poder utilizar melhor o Amarok.

Análise incremental / Atualizar coleção

A análise incremental irá procurar por atualizações nas pastas da coleção. Isto é feito a cada minuto se a opção Monitorar as alterações nas faixas estiver ativada, mas também poderá ser acionada manualmente ao escolher a opção Atualizar coleção no menu.

A análise incremental irá verificar apenas a data de modificação de cada pasta da coleção, em comparação com a última data de modificação conhecida. Isto tem algumas implicações:

  • Você pode acionar a reanálise de uma pasta se modificar a sua hora de modificação (por exemplo, se usar o touch /caminho/pasta na linha de comando).
  • Se os arquivos dentro de uma pasta forem alterados, o analisador não irá perceber a alteração, pois a alteração de um arquivo atualiza a sua hora de modificação, mas não a hora de modificação da pasta-mãe. Por outro lado, a maioria dos programas que modificam arquivos, fazem-no de forma atômica, usando um arquivo temporário que depois é renomeado. Esse procedimento atualiza a hora de modificação da pasta e, assim, aciona uma nova análise da pasta.
  • Se as pastas da coleção estiverem em uma partição muito lenta, o processo de verificação de todas as horas de modificação poderá levar algum tempo. Normalmente, esta informação fica em cache no sistema operacional, mas com grandes coleções isso pode não ser possível. Nesse caso, o analisador pode parecer que continua indefinidamente. Em coleções com milhares de pastas ou quando as coleções são armazenadas em uma unidade de rede ou partição NTFS, recomenda-se desativar a opção Monitorar pastas por alterações.

Se tiver problemas com as faixas excluídas que continuam a aparecer na coleção, ou caso queira atualizar as capas do álbum (que não são atualizadas ao executar a opção Atualizar coleção), então você poderá usar a Análise completa na janela de configurações. A Análise completa não se preocupa com datas de modificação e não excluirá as estatísticas dos arquivos existentes. No entanto, excluirá as estatísticas das faixas que desapareceram das pastas da coleção que estiverem montadas. Por este motivo, é aconselhável efetuar a Análise completa apenas com todas as pastas da Coleção local montadas, se mover as faixas entre montagens. A Análise completa também atualiza o número de reproduções se o que estiver armazenado nas etiquetas dos arquivos for maior, a classificação se a música ainda não estiver classificada e as etiquetas dos arquivos que tiverem informações sobre as classificações e pontuações (nas mesmas circunstâncias).

Barra de progresso / tempo de análise

A barra de progresso irá mostrar a evolução da análise. Até os 50%, o analisador irá verificar o sistema de arquivos e registrar temporariamente o resultado. O período acima dos 50% indica que o analisador está armazenando os resultados no banco de dados. Normalmente, o segundo passo é muito mais rápido que o primeiro, por isso não se surpreenda caso a barra de progresso avançar rapidamente. Até os 50% é possível interromper a análise. Após os 50%, a gravação dos dados não pode ser interrompida.

O tempo de análise depende da velocidade do seu disco e de outros fatores. Normalmente, a primeira análise é bem mais lenta que as seguintes, pelo fato de que os arquivos se encontram na cache do sistema operacional. Uma análise de 10.000 arquivos deve levar cerca de três minutos em um computador moderno. 50.000 arquivos deve demorar cerca de 13 minutos. Obviamente, com uma unidade SSD isto será muito mais rápido.

Cópia de segurança da coleção

Com a configuração padrão, o Amarok armazena todas as informações da coleção em uma pasta chamada ~.kde/share/apps/amarok/mysqle/. Pode ser uma boa ideia fazer uma cópia de segurança desta pasta de tempos em tempos, principalmente quando não tiver ativado a reposição da informação das estatísticas.

Sobre os IDs únicos

O Amarok registra os arquivos com base em um ID que é armazenado na faixa de áudio ou calculado com base nos metadados do arquivo, nos metadados das etiquetas e nos primeiros kilobytes do arquivo. Este ID ajuda o Amarok a identificar as faixas que foram movidas para outros locais, para que as informações estatísticas (classificação, pontuação, número de reproduções, primeira e última reproduções) não sejam perdidas. Atualmente, o Amarok não irá importar as faixas com IDs duplicados. Isto leva a um comportamento estranho, onde as faixas copiadas aparecem apenas uma vez no Amarok.

Em algumas circunstâncias, até mesmo faixas diferentes poderão ficar com o mesmo ID único. Estes problemas podem ser vistos no resultado de depuração (inicie o Amarok com a opção --debug em um terminal) durante a análise.

Sobre os álbuns

O analisador só pode ler faixas individuais, mas o Amarok irá mostrá-las ordenadas pelo álbum e compilação (um álbum sem artista específico). O Amarok não consegue se basear na pasta onde os arquivos estão localizados, uma vez que os esquemas de organização das pastas variam bastante.

O analisador está fazendo o seguinte:

  • As faixas sem um artista ou álbum (ou um compositor, no caso de uma faixa de música clássica) são colocadas em uma compilação.
  • As faixas que estejam marcadas como compilações ou com um artista do álbum que não seja vários artistas serão colocadas em um álbum.
  • As faixas que tenham a marca de compilação como 0 são colocadas em uma compilação.
  • Os álbuns chamados "Best of", "Anthology", "Hit collection", "Greatest Hits", "All Time Greatest Hits" e "Live" são sempre tratados como um álbum.
  • Se tiver concluído com várias faixas de diferentes artistas serão colocadas dentro de uma compilação; por outro lado poderá criar um álbum com base nelas.

Este processo é bastante complicado. Entretanto, normalmente os resultados das análises podem ajudar a descobrir o motivo pelo qual as faixas são ordenadas desta forma.

Nesse caso, tente executar (na linha de comando)

amarokcollectionscanner -r ~/sua/pasta/músicas

Procure pelas etiquetas "compilation" e pelas faixas com diferentes etiquetas de "artista" e "artista do álbum".

Você pode remover a etiqueta de compilação dos arquivos MP3 com o seguinte comando:

id3v2 -r TCMP seu nome de arquivo aqui